Classic Tiramisu

A delightful no-bake dessert of layered coffee-soaked ladyfingers and creamy mascarpone, perfect for any celebration.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up strong brewed coffee, cooled
  • 3 large egg yolks
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up mascarpone cheese
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2430 ladyfinger cookies
  • 2 tablespoons cocoa powder

Instructions

  1. Brew the Coffee Mix: In a bowl, mix the cooled coffee with a splash of coffee liqueur if desired.
  2. Whisk the Egg Yolks and Sugar: In another bowl, whisk together the egg yolks and granulated sugar until light and creamy.
  3. Incorporate the Mascarpone Cheese: Gently fold the mascarpone cheese into the egg mixture until smooth.
  4. Whip the Heavy Cream: In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ream and vanilla extract until stiff peaks form.
  5. Fold the Whipped Cream: Gently fold the whipped cream into the mascarpone mixture.
  6. Prepare the Ladyfingers: Dip each ladyfinger into the coffee mixture for just a second and layer in your serving dish.
  7. Layer the Mascarpone Mixture: Spread half of the mascarpone mixture over the ladyfingers.
  8. Repeat the Layering: Repeat with another layer of dipped ladyfingers and top with the remaining mascarpone mixture.
  9. Chill: Chill in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ours or overnight.
  10. Dust with Cocoa Powder: Before serving, dust with cocoa powder for that final touch of elegance.

Notes

Ensure ingredients are at room temperature and use high-quality coffee for the best flavor.
